次の方法で共有


JWTAuthenticatorProperties interface

JWTAuthenticatorのプロパティ。 JWT オーセンティケーターのプロパティを構成する方法の詳細については、Kubernetes のドキュメント https://kubernetes.io/docs/reference/access-authn-authz/authentication/#using-authentication-configuration を参照してください。 Kubernetes ドキュメントで使用できるすべてのフィールドが AKS でサポートされているわけではないことに注意してください。 トラブルシューティングについては、 https://aka.ms/aks-external-issuers-docsを参照してください。

プロパティ

claimMappings

トークン要求からユーザー属性を抽出する方法を定義するマッピング。

claimValidationRules

ユーザーを認証するためのトークン要求を検証するために適用される規則。 検証を成功させるには、すべての式が true と評価される必要があります。

issuer

JWT OIDC 発行者の詳細。

provisioningState

JWT オーセンティケーターの現在のプロビジョニング状態。 注: このプロパティはシリアル化されません。 サーバーによってのみ設定できます。

userValidationRules

認証を完了する前にマップされたユーザーに適用されるルール。 検証を成功させるには、すべての式が true と評価される必要があります。

プロパティの詳細

claimMappings

トークン要求からユーザー属性を抽出する方法を定義するマッピング。

claimMappings: JWTAuthenticatorClaimMappings

プロパティ値

claimValidationRules

ユーザーを認証するためのトークン要求を検証するために適用される規則。 検証を成功させるには、すべての式が true と評価される必要があります。

claimValidationRules?: JWTAuthenticatorValidationRule[]

プロパティ値

issuer

JWT OIDC 発行者の詳細。

issuer: JWTAuthenticatorIssuer

プロパティ値

provisioningState

JWT オーセンティケーターの現在のプロビジョニング状態。 注: このプロパティはシリアル化されません。 サーバーによってのみ設定できます。

provisioningState?: string

プロパティ値

string

userValidationRules

認証を完了する前にマップされたユーザーに適用されるルール。 検証を成功させるには、すべての式が true と評価される必要があります。

userValidationRules?: JWTAuthenticatorValidationRule[]

プロパティ値